Shaq Crams His Way Into Cavs Lineup

Shaquille O'Neal, arguably the best big man to ever lace up a pair of sneakers (I've still got Wilt, Kareem and Hakeem ahead of him), has reportedly been traded to the Cleveland Cavaliers where he'll team with reigning MVP LeBron James. Shaq, as most fans know him, has played for several teams throughout his illustrious career including the Los Angeles Lakers, with whom he won three titles alongside Kobe Bryant. The trade was made in part to help Cleveland compete with the Orlando Magic, who defeated the Cavs in the Eastern Conference Finals to face the Lakers. The Lakers then went on to beat the Magic in a tougher-than-it-appeared five game series to bring the title home to Los Angeles.
